Output b5817cc971a4e409fbf2a1edca1121a48ff8197cd7bbee63aef24c7e93099c7a:0

value
113252644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81fa68d80881ca8c511c2331f89a362342afbd3 OP_EQUAL
address
3MPmo6pTuKiZopT6jtLpremtzcQuHJ7EBC
transaction
b5817cc971a4e409fbf2a1edca1121a48ff8197cd7bbee63aef24c7e93099c7a
confirmations
470552
spent
true